4-Day Amsterdam Adventure

Viewed by 56 travelers
Friday, January 26

Start your Amsterdam adventure by immersing yourself in the city's rich history and culture. In the morning, visit the Anne Frank House, a thought-provoking museum that tells the story of Anne Frank and her hiding place during World War II. Explore the canals of Amsterdam in the afternoon by taking a scenic boat tour, admiring the picturesque bridges and charming architecture. As the evening sets in, head to the lively Leidseplein Square where you can enjoy a night of entertainment at one of the many theaters, comedy clubs, or live music venues.

  • Anne Frank House: Approx. €14, 2 hours
  • Scenic Boat Tour: Approx. €20, 1.5 hours
  • Leidseplein Square: Free admission, time spent varies
Saturday, January 27

Get ready to explore Amsterdam's artistic side on day two. Start your morning by visiting the world-renowned Van Gogh Museum, which houses an extensive collection of artworks by Vincent van Gogh. In the afternoon, take a walk through the charming Jordaan neighborhood, known for its quaint streets and art galleries. Make a stop at the Anne Frank statue in the nearby Westerkerk square. Wrap up your day with a visit to the bustling Museumplein, where you will find the iconic Rijksmuseum and the striking I amsterdam sign.

  • Van Gogh Museum: Approx. €20, 2-3 hours
  • Jordaan Neighborhood: Free admission, time spent varies
  • Museumplein: Free admission, time spent varies
Sunday, January 28

Immerse yourself in nature and Dutch countryside on day three. Start your morning by taking a 30-minute train ride from Amsterdam Centraal to Zaanse Schans, a historic village renowned for its well-preserved windmills. Explore the picturesque surroundings and visit the traditional crafts and clog-making demonstration. Afterward, make your way to Volendam, a charming fishing village on the shores of the IJsselmeer lake. Enjoy fresh seafood for lunch and soak in the delightful atmosphere. In the evening, return to Amsterdam and indulge in a delicious Dutch dinner at one of the city's cozy restaurants.

  • Zaanse Schans: Free admission, time spent varies
  • Volendam: Free admission, time spent varies
  • Dutch Dinner: Approx. €25, time spent varies

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

Away from the typical tourist spots, Amsterdam has many hidden gems and attractions loved by locals. Pay a visit to the hidden courtyard gardens of Begijnhof, an oasis of tranquility in the heart of the city. Explore the charming Nine Streets (De Negen Straatjes), known for its boutique shops and cozy cafes. For a unique experience, rent a bike and pedal your way through Vondelpark or along the scenic Amstel River. Don't forget to try some local delicacies such as stroopwafels (syrup waffles) and bitterballen (deep-fried meatballs) in one of the cozy brown cafes dotted throughout the city.
